Review of IWEA autumn conference messages • Minister Foster • Target for 2025 likely to be 40% from renewables • Taylored ROCs consultation • Offshore ROCs are administered and need to be in line with GB • IWEA • We had the all-island Grid Study • The time for action is now • Co-ordinated action required by government departments and utilities • Wind farm developers investing heavily but need to have obstacles removed • Benefits include job creation as well as value to customers and climate change.
